Mitski shares new video for Nobody

Be the Cowboy, Mitski’s fifth album, is out 17 August.

Former Crack Magazine cover star Mitski dropped a new track, the second to be taken from her forthcoming album Be the Cowboy. Nobody is follow-up to lead single Geyser, and is accompanied by a surreal, primary-coloured video directed by Christopher Good. You can watch the video via the player above.

In a press statement, Mitski said: “We shot this video over five days, in both sides of Kansas City. I’ve never been able to take this much time to shoot a video, so it was  wonderful to have the space to get the details right, as well as actually hang out and have fun with everyone involved.

“This video made me fall unexpectedly in love with Kansas City”.
